    Nokia 2.2 User Guide 7 Internet and connections ACTIVATE WI-FI Using a Wi-Fi connection is generally faster and less expensive than using a mobile data connection. If both Wi-Fi and mobile data connections are available, your phone uses the Wi- Fi connection.

    Nokia 2.2 User Guide Turn on airplane mode 1. Tap Settings > Network & Internet > Advanced . 2. Switch on Airplane mode . Airplane mode closes connections to the mobile network and switches your device’s wireless features off. Comply with the instructions and safety requirements given by, for example, an airline, and any applicable laws and regulations.

    Nokia 2.2 User Guide Share your content using Bluetooth If you want to share your photos or other content with a friend, send them to your friend’s phone using Bluetooth. You can use more than one Bluetooth connection at a time. For example, while using a Bluetooth headset, you can still send things to another phone.

  • Page 35 Nokia 2.2 User Guide Wi-Fi positioning improves positioning accuracy when satellite signals are not available, especially when you are indoors or between tall buildings. If you’re in a place where the use of Wi-Fi is restricted, you can switch Wi-Fi off in your phone settings.

    Nokia 2.2 User Guide CHANGE YOUR SIM PIN CODE If your SIM card came with a default SIM PIN code, you can change it to something more secure. Not all network service providers support this. Select your SIM PIN You can choose which digits to use for the SIM PIN. The SIM PIN code can be 4-8 digits.
  • Page 42 Nokia 2.2 User Guide Lock code Lock code is also known as security code or password. The lock code helps you protect your phone against unauthorized use. You can set your phone to ask for the lock code that you define. Keep the code secret and in a safe place, separate from your phone.

    Nokia 2.2 User Guide The device and/or its screen is made of glass. This glass can break if the device is dropped on a hard surface or receives a substantial impact. If the glass breaks, do not touch the glass parts of the device or attempt to remove the broken glass from the device.
